<h2 style="font-weight: bold; margin: 12px 0;">Nutritional Requirements for Adolescent Growth</h2>

During adolescence, the body undergoes significant growth spurts, necessitating increased nutritional support. Essential nutrients such as protein, calcium, vitamin D, and various micronutrients are crucial for bone development and overall growth. Adequate protein intake is particularly vital as it supports muscle development and repair, contributing to overall height gain. Calcium and vitamin D play a key role in bone mineralization, ensuring the attainment of peak bone mass during adolescence, which directly influences adult height.

<h2 style="font-weight: bold; margin: 12px 0;">The Role of Macronutrients and Micronutrients</h2>

Macronutrients, including carbohydrates, proteins, and fats, provide the energy required for growth and physical activities. Carbohydrates serve as the primary energy source, enabling adolescents to engage in various physical activities that support overall growth and development. Proteins, comprising essential amino acids, are fundamental for tissue growth and repair, including the development of muscles and bones. Additionally, micronutrients such as iron, zinc, and vitamin A are essential for various physiological processes, including hormone production and immune function, which are integral to adolescent growth.

<h2 style="font-weight: bold; margin: 12px 0;">Impact of Malnutrition on Adolescent Growth</h2>

Inadequate nutrition during adolescence can lead to stunted growth and delayed development. Malnutrition, whether due to insufficient intake or poor dietary quality, can hinder the attainment of optimal height and overall physical development. Deficiencies in key nutrients, such as protein, calcium, and vitamins, can impede bone growth and mineralization, resulting in compromised stature and increased susceptibility to skeletal disorders. Furthermore, micronutrient deficiencies can disrupt hormonal balance and metabolic processes, negatively impacting growth and maturation.

<h2 style="font-weight: bold; margin: 12px 0;">Dietary Recommendations for Maximizing Growth Potential</h2>

To support healthy growth during adolescence, it is imperative to emphasize a balanced and nutrient-dense diet. Encouraging the consumption of lean proteins, dairy products, fruits, vegetables, and whole grains can provide the essential nutrients required for optimal growth. Additionally, promoting adequate hydration and limiting the intake of processed foods and sugary beverages can contribute to overall health and facilitate proper growth. Dietary diversity and portion control are essential considerations to ensure the fulfillment of nutritional requirements without excess or deficiency.
